Hanul Nuclear Power Plant Holds 'Meeting' for Win-Win Cooperation with 12 Partner Companies... "Promise of Mutual Growth"
[Asia Economy Yeongnam Reporting Headquarters Reporter Dongwook Park] Korea Hydro & Nuclear Power Co., Ltd. Hanul Nuclear Power Headquarters (Head Lee Jong-ho) announced on the 18th that it held a 'Win-Win Cooperation Special Meeting' by inviting partner companies of the headquarters.
The meeting, attended by 12 partner companies including Gangwoo Enterprise Co., Ltd. and Goryeo Industrial Corporation Co., Ltd., was conducted with guidance on KHNP's win-win growth support policies, sharing of current issues, and listening to difficulties and suggestions from partner companies.
Head Lee Jong-ho emphasized, "We will continue to strive to build a clean and win-win cooperative relationship to become partners who grow together with partner companies. Let us continue to work together to create a sound nuclear power industry ecosystem."
